Braces, { and }, are used to represent a set of answers.
If the answers to a problem are the numbers 4 and 2, this answer can be expressed as {4, 2}.
Also, {7} means that the answer is 7.
If there is no number between the braces, you have an "empty set", and there is no answer. So: { } means that the problem does not have an answer.
